What Does a Parts Delivery Driver Do?

A Parts Delivery Driver transports automotive parts and supplies between dealerships, repair shops, collision centers, fleet operations, and commercial accounts. These positions often work closely with:
  • Parts departments
  • Wholesale customers
  • Service advisors
  • Repair shops
  • Collision centers
  • Fleet operations
  • Fixed operations leadership
Strong delivery drivers help improve customer service, repair turnaround times, and wholesale account relationships.

Common Responsibilities

Typical responsibilities may include:
  • Delivering automotive parts to commercial customers
  • Loading and unloading inventory safely
  • Verifying invoices and delivery paperwork
  • Maintaining organized delivery routes and schedules
  • Supporting wholesale and dealership parts operations
  • Communicating with customers regarding deliveries
  • Returning cores and documentation
  • Assisting with inventory and warehouse organization
  • Maintaining clean and professional delivery vehicles
  • Supporting customer satisfaction and account retention
In busy wholesale operations, reliability, professionalism, and time management are extremely important.

Why These Jobs Stay in Demand

Fast and accurate parts delivery directly affects:
  • Service department productivity
  • Repair shop turnaround time
  • Customer satisfaction
  • Wholesale account retention
  • Collision repair scheduling
  • Fleet maintenance operations
Dealerships and wholesale operations rely heavily on dependable delivery drivers to maintain customer relationships and support efficient repair operations. That’s why experienced automotive delivery professionals remain in demand throughout the automotive industry.

Career Growth Opportunities

Many professionals begin as:
  • Parts delivery drivers
  • Warehouse support staff
  • Inventory clerks
  • Automotive support personnel
Over time, they often advance into:
  • Parts counter positions
  • Wholesale account management
  • Inventory management
  • Parts department leadership
  • Fixed operations support roles
  • Automotive operations management
For motivated employees, dealership parts delivery positions can become strong long-term automotive career opportunities.
